Beşiktaş's new transfer, David Jurasek, received intense criticism on social media following his performance in the match against Shakhtar Donetsk. Unable to withstand the negative comments, especially on Instagram, the Czech player closed his account. However, after black-and-white fans sent supportive messages to the player's wife and provided positive feedback, Jurasek reactivated his Instagram account.
